Step-by-Step Instructions

Prepare the Doughnut Batter

In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t. Make sure the ingredients are well incorporated and there are no clumps.

Combine Wet Ingredients

In a separate bowl, whisk together the milk, egg, melted butter, and vanilla extract. Thoroughly combine the wet ingredients.

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ients

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ients. Stir until just combined; do not overmix. Overmixing can result in tough doughnuts.

Form the Doughnuts

Spoon the batter into a piping bag and create a small circle on parchment paper. Alternatively, you can drop dollops using a spoon.

Air Fry the Doughnuts

Preheat your air fryer to 350°F (175°C). Carefully place the doughnuts into the air fryer basket in a single layer.

Cook the Doughnuts

Air fry for 6-8 minutes. The doughnuts should be golden brown and cooked through. The cooking time may vary slightly depending on your air fryer. Check at the 6-minute mark.

Prepare the Glaze

While the doughnuts are cooking, prepare the glaze by whisking together the powdered sugar and milk (or water) in a small bowl until smooth.

Glaze and Serve

Once the doughnuts are cool enough to handle, dip them in the glaze. Add sprinkles immediately if desired, and serve these delightful treats right away.

Chef Tips for Perfect Results

  • Preheat your air fryer for consistent cooking. This will help your doughnuts cook evenly.

  • Don’t overcrowd the air fryer. Cook the doughnuts in batches to ensure they cook evenly and have space to rise.

  • Use fresh ingredients, especially baking powder, for the best rise and flavor. Check the expiration date.

  • Check for doneness with a toothpick. Insert it into the center; if it comes out clean, they are done.

  • Let the doughnuts cool slightly before glazing to prevent the glaze from running off.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  1. Overmixing the batter: Overmixing develops the gluten, resulting in dense doughnuts. Solution: Mix until just combined.

  2. Air frying at too high a temperature: Causes the outside to burn before the inside cooks. Solution: Follow recommended temperature in the recipe.

  3. Not preheating the air fryer: This can lead to uneven cooking. Solution: Always preheat your air fryer.

  4. Overcrowding the air fryer basket: Prevents proper airflow, leading to undercooked doughnuts. Solution: Cook in batches.

  5. Using old baking powder: This prevents the doughnuts from rising. Solution: Always check your baking powder’s expiration date.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use pre-made biscuit dough to make air fryer doughnuts?

You can certainly make air fryer doughnuts with biscuit dough for a simplified approach. Use your favorite refrigerated biscuit dough. Cut holes in the center of the biscuits to create the doughnut shape. Air fry according to the package directions, and then glaze.

How do I know when my air fryer doughnuts are done?

The best way to determine if your air fryer doughnuts are done is to check for a golden brown color and a firm texture. You can also insert a toothpick into the center; if it comes out clean, they are ready. If the tops are browning too quickly, lower the temperature slightly and keep a close eye.

Why are my air fryer doughnuts dry?

Your doughnuts might be dry due to overcooking or overmixing the batter. Always follow the cooking time. Ensure you are not overmixing the batter after adding the wet ingredients. A touch of extra butter can also add moisture.

Can I make air fryer doughnuts ahead of time?

Yes, air fryer doughnuts can be made in advance. Allow them to cool completely, and then store them in an airtight container. However, they are best enjoyed fresh. You can also freeze them.
